Decoding Your AC Thermostat's Wiring Diagram

At its core, a "Wiring Diagram for Ac Unit Thermostat" is a visual representation that illustrates the electrical connections between your thermostat and the various components of your air conditioning and heating system. These diagrams are essential for anyone installing a new thermostat, troubleshooting a malfunctioning unit, or even making minor modifications to their system's setup. They break down complex electrical pathways into a simplified, understandable format, using standardized color codes and terminal labels to indicate where each wire should connect. Without a clear understanding of this diagram, attempting any wiring work can lead to system damage or safety hazards.

The primary purpose of the wiring diagram is to ensure proper electrical flow for controlling the different functions of your HVAC system. Different wires are responsible for specific commands:

  • R (Power): This wire provides the 24-volt power necessary for the thermostat to operate.
  • C (Common): While not always present on older thermostats, the C wire provides a continuous 24-volt current to power the thermostat's electronics, especially for digital and smart models.
  • W (Heat): This wire signals the heating system to turn on.
  • Y (Cool): This wire signals the air conditioning system to turn on.
  • G (Fan): This wire controls the operation of the fan in your HVAC system.
  • O/B (Reversing Valve): Primarily for heat pumps, this wire controls the reversing valve to switch between heating and cooling modes.

These are the most common terminals, but more complex systems might include additional wires for features like multi-stage heating or cooling, or humidifiers/dehumidifiers. The diagram will clearly show how these wires connect to specific terminals on both the thermostat and the control board of your HVAC unit.

When you encounter a wiring diagram, you'll typically see a series of terminals on the thermostat side, each labeled with a letter. Correspondingly, your HVAC unit's control board will have similar terminals. The diagram then uses lines to show which wire from your HVAC unit connects to which terminal on your thermostat. It’s important to note that wire colors can vary between manufacturers, but the terminal labels (R, C, W, Y, G, etc.) are generally standardized. Always refer to the specific diagram that came with your thermostat or HVAC unit for the most accurate information. Here's a simplified example of how terminals might be represented:

Thermostat Terminal Typical Wire Color Function
R Red Power
W White Heat
Y Yellow Cool
G Green Fan
